Herzig’s 63 Makes History in Win at St. Bonaventure
Team Leaderboard | Individual Leaderboard
OLEAN, N.Y. – Robbie Herzig made history with the program's lowest round (63) and the lowest in relation to par (-8) to win the Duel at Bartlett on Sunday at Bartlett Country Club.
Herzig's 7-under 63 on Sunday bested the program record of 66 shared by Dugan McCabe, Mark Gertsen, and Ryan Skae (twice). His 8-under in relation to par topped four Raiders who shared the program record at 5-under. Herzig was one of them (Battle at Rum Pointe, 2023).
Colgate's 36-hole total of 560 tied the program record held by the 2021-22 Raiders who set the mark during the Bucknell Invitational in October 2021. Colgate beat St. Bonaventure by 17 strokes to win the head-to-head battle on Sunday.
Herzig was on fire from the get-go on Sunday. He turned in a 29 through the first nine holes with five birdies and an eagle on the 294-yard, par-4 fifth hole. Herzig added three more birdies back nine to finish at 7-under 63, winning the outright title by seven strokes at 8-under 132.
Kevin Hollomon tied with St. Bonaventure's Peter Byrne for second place at 1-under 139. Hollomon was even on Sunday, turning in a 70 after finishing strong with birdies on three of the last five holes. Justin Fedele finished sixth at 5-over 145.
Michael Hanratty, playing as an individual, improved by six strokes on Sunday to finish with a 76-70=146 (+6) two-day total in sixth place. Leo Li and Dugan McCabe tied for 10th at 11-over (151).
